CVE-2022-36182
Last modified
CVE-2022-36182 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 6.1/10 on the CVSS scale. Hashicorp Boundary v0.8.0 is vulnerable to Clickjacking which allow for the interception of login credentials, re-direction of users to malicious sites, or causing users to perform malicious actions on the site.. EPSS estimates a 0.54%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
